Transaction f0d8eacda836e23c52533aedd0c3df690e6412380a08babfab589beba81f211a
1 Input
1 Output
-
f0d8eacda836e23c52533aedd0c3df690e6412380a08babfab589beba81f211a:0
- value
- 337829
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d19f41440ea47e47b198233c9636a91d9c1be35 OP_EQUAL
- address
- 3Mr6MDPnkdPfdqkE4gNHpWULx9tcRB7Lvk